Grips Intelligence data shows that across the January 1–June 30, 2026 period, TEKTON tracked across offline retail channels including Home Depot, Lowe's, and Amazon, with an overall revenue increase of 22.5%. TEKTON is a privately held, family-owned company led by CEO John Amash, based in Grand Rapids, Michigan, so no public stock ticker applies. According to Grips Intelligence, Home Depot commanded the largest share of in-store revenue at 50.0%, followed closely by Lowe's at 45.6%, while Amazon trailed at just 4.3%. The brand's average product price climbed to $69.10 in the most recent month, reflecting a 10.3% increase over the period. With an overall average product price of $62.34 and steady month-over-month revenue growth of 19.0%, Grips Intelligence data points to sustained upward momentum for TEKTON through mid-2026.
